PFND3D11_1DDI_VIDEOPROCESSORSETOUTPUTCONSTRICTION função de retorno de chamada (d3d10umddi.h)
Define a quantidade de downsampling a ser executada na saída.
Sintaxe
PFND3D11_1DDI_VIDEOPROCESSORSETOUTPUTCONSTRICTION Pfnd3d111DdiVideoprocessorsetoutputconstriction;
void Pfnd3d111DdiVideoprocessorsetoutputconstriction(
D3D10DDI_HDEVICE unnamedParam1,
D3D11_1DDI_HVIDEOPROCESSOR unnamedParam2,
BOOL unnamedParam3,
SIZE unnamedParam4
)
{...}
Parâmetros
unnamedParam1
hDevice [in]
Um identificador para o dispositivo de exibição (contexto gráfico).
unnamedParam2
hVideoProcessor [in]
Um identificador para o objeto do processador de vídeo que foi criado por meio de uma chamada para a função CreateVideoProcessor.
unnamedParam3
habilitado [in]
Se VERDADEIRO, o downsampling estará habilitado. Caso contrário, o downsampling será desabilitado e o membro do ConstrictonSize será ignorado.
unnamedParam4
ConstrictonSize [in]
O tamanho da amostragem.
Valor de retorno
Nenhum
Observações
Às vezes, o downsampling é usado para reduzir a qualidade do conteúdo premium quando outras formas de proteção de conteúdo não estão disponíveis.
Por padrão, o downsampling está desabilitado.
Se o parâmetro Habilitar for TRUE, o driver de miniporto de exibição reduzirá a imagem composta para o tamanho especificado e a dimensionará novamente para o tamanho do retângulo de destino.
A largura e a altura do parâmetro ConstrictonSize devem ser maiores que zero. Se o tamanho for maior do que o retângulo de destino, não ocorrerá downsampling.
O driver relata sua capacidade de dar suporte ao downsampling por meio da função getVideoProcessorCaps. Se o driver der suporte à funcionalidade D3D11_1DDI_VIDEO_PROCESSOR_FEATURE_CAPS_CONSTRICTION, ele oferecerá suporte à capacidade de reduzir o tamanho da imagem composta.
Requisitos
Requisito | Valor |
---|---|
de cliente com suporte mínimo | Windows 8 |
servidor com suporte mínimo | Windows Server 2012 |
da Plataforma de Destino | Área de trabalho |
cabeçalho | d3d10umddi.h (inclua D3d10umddi.h) |